    What symptoms might indicate the need for a calcium test?

    Symptoms suggesting the need for a calcium test include muscle cramps, fatigue, bone pain, frequent fractures, numbness or tingling, and abnormal heart rhythms. These signs may indicate hypocalcemia or hypercalcemia, conditions requiring timely diagnosis and treatment. The test is also useful for monitoring conditions like osteoporosis, kidney disease, or parathyroid disorders.
